About the role

We are seeking a Web Production Specialist to maintain and enhance the Office of the Vice President for Research (OVPR) public-facing websites and intranet using Drupal. This role involves managing website content, functionality, accessibility, links, forms, search, and access restrictions; staging, publishing, and validating website updates; and coordinating changes with communications staff and subject-matter experts.
